Transaction 11ed79f2342c5389679e491f6ab37a62a0dd2015d7529a5828744b863ba2f31f

1 Input
1 Outputs
  • 11ed79f2342c5389679e491f6ab37a62a0dd2015d7529a5828744b863ba2f31f:0
  • value  361015
    address  3QCTmhDYP6qcXo13nFQFEkyUps1NCuB4Bu